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Pastenague à nez pointu | brown-throated conure |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(animal) | Animalia (animal)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Elasmobranchii | Aves (oiseau) |
| Order | Myliobatiformes (Myliobatiformes) | Psittaciformes (Parrots) |
| Family | Dasyatidae | Psittacidae (True Parrots) |
| Genus | Pateobatis | Aratinga |
| Species | Pateobatis jenkinsii | Aratinga pertinax |
